Built a mini-itx system for a firewall setup and using 12.04.1 server
installer it will not boot after install. If I use the original 12.04
installer that has 3.2.0-23 kernel it will boot just fine without
issues. I can run all updates except for updating to the new kernel
3.2.0-30 which will fail to boot and Grub will let me choose 3.2.0-23.
Has anyone experienced this?

System specs are:
Jetway JNF9A-Q67
Core i3-2120T
Corsair Vengeance LP DDR3 2x4GB
